G-Forum 2016 – Submissions

Submission types

Full paper submissions

It is possible to submit full papers to the G-Forum. Authors of full paper submissions receive a developmental review from a member of the editorial board of the conference.

Abstract submissions

It is also possible to submit an abstract (not more than 1,000 words).

Please submit your full papers and/or abstract in two versions (with author and without author) as a pdf-document until June 12th, 2016 via Email to submission-gforum2016@fgf-ev.de.

Submission details (for full papers and abstracts)

  • The conference is open for both research- and practice-oriented submissions. Please state in your submission e-mail to which category your paper belongs.
  • Please submit a blind manuscript (a manuscript without author names) and a manuscript with full author names and correspondence addresses.
  • Submissions can be either in English or German.
  • Submissions of scientific contributions should ideally be broken down as follows: • Problem (research gap / objective) • Theoretical Foundation • Methodology / empirical research context • Results • Implications for entrepreneurship research and practice
  • Submissions of practical contributions should at least include a clear starting point, objective, relevant results and implications for practice.
